documentation for agate

Agate is a Python data analysis library that is optimized for humans instead of machines. It is an alternative to numpy and pandas that solves real-world problems with readable code.

Why agate?

  - A readable and user-friendly API.
  - A complete set of SQL-like operations.
  - Unicode support everywhere.
  - Decimal precision everywhere.
  - Exhaustive user documentation.
  - Pluggable extensions that add SQL integration, Excel support, and more.
  - Designed with iPython, Jupyter and atom/hydrogen in mind.
  - Pure Python. No C dependencies to compile.
  - Exhaustive test coverage.
  - MIT licensed and free for all purposes.
  - Zealously zen.
  - Made with love.

This package provides the documentation.
